I am a Colombian cuir (queer) writer, visual artist, and independent curator based in Germany.
I am a member of abraso art collective and co-director of .efímera publishing house.

Statement

As a constant game of moving words and images, my work digs into the cracks of affection, sexuality, pleasures, and power. In the intersections of writing, cinema, photography, and performance, I portray personal stories —myself and others— seeking fractures inside patriarchal discourses. For the last few years, living with HIV has shifted my art practice to reflect on the tensions of body, language, and space. Hence, through methodologies and mediums of reproduction and rearrangement, I create textual and viral imagery such as artbooks, performative readings, films, short stories, visual essays, and poems. My research wonders about viruses as metaphors, cities as organisms, streets as stories, poetics of daily life, and the motions of intimacy and grief.
